Eliot Miranda uploaded a new version of VMMaker to project VM Maker:
http://source.squeak.org/VMMaker/VMMaker.oscog-eem.2550.mcz

==================== Summary ====================

Name: VMMaker.oscog-eem.2550
Author: eem
Time: 5 September 2019, 2:35:03.722412 pm
UUID: ee7482ae-8091-4a50-8a5a-316fac3479b1
Ancestors: VMMaker.oscog-nice.2549

Simplify the recenty changed Interpreter{rimitives (small)float primitives to avoid using cppIf:; since the distinction between 32-bit and 64-bit VM versions is handled at generation time different VM sources are generated for each and hence cppIf: is neither needed nor appropriate.

Set hasYoungReferrer via an accessor; this in anticipation of adding a cmHasLiteral bit that will be used in Spur to optimize post-become adding of methods to the YoungReferrer list and of literal variable access.  Refactor method zone printing to provide summaries of the number of methods, and the number of methods on the young referrer and open pic lists.

  ----- Method: Cogit>>genLoadInlineCacheWithSelector: (in category 'in-line cacheing') -----
  genLoadInlineCacheWithSelector: selectorIndex
  	"The in-line cache for a send is implemented as a constant load into ClassReg.
  	 We always use a 32-bit load, even in 64-bits.
  
  	 In the initial (unlinked) state the in-line cache is notionally loaded with the selector.
  	 But since in 64-bits an arbitrary selector oop won't fit in a 32-bit constant load, we
  	 instead load the cache with the selector's index, either into the literal frame of the
  	 current method, or into the special selector array.  Negative values are 1-relative
  	 indices into the special selector array.
  
  	 When a send is linked, the load of the selector, or selector index, is overwritten with a
  	 load of the receiver's class, or class tag.  Hence, the 64-bit VM is currently constrained
  	 to use class indices as cache tags.  If out-of-line literals are used, distinct caches /must
  	 not/ share acche locations, for if they do, send cacheing will be confused by the sharing.
  	 Hence we use the MoveUniqueC32:R: instruction that will not share literal locations."
  
  	| cacheValue |
  	self assert: (selectorIndex < 0
  					ifTrue: [selectorIndex negated between: 1 and: self numSpecialSelectors]
  					ifFalse: [selectorIndex between: 0 and: (objectMemory literalCountOf: methodObj) - 1]).
  
  	self inlineCacheTagsAreIndexes
  		ifTrue:
  			[cacheValue := selectorIndex]
  		ifFalse:
  			[| selector |
  			 selector := selectorIndex < 0
  							ifTrue: [(coInterpreter specialSelector: -1 - selectorIndex)]
  							ifFalse: [self getLiteral: selectorIndex].
  			 self assert: (objectMemory addressCouldBeOop: selector).
  			 (objectMemory isYoung: selector) ifTrue:
+ 				[self setHasYoungReferent: true].
- 				[hasYoungReferent := true].
  			 cacheValue := selector].
  
  	self MoveUniqueC32: cacheValue R: ClassReg!
